Roles and Responsibilities




Ensure off dock schedules are met. Ensure all inbound flights are de-catered and departing flights are catered in time to meet current SLAs. Liaise with airlines and their handling agents to ensure all departure times and current SLAs are met. Ensure block plans are checked and update the following day/weeks flights. Ensure block plans are followed and updated and Driver and TSA teams allocated to meet departure times and SLAs. Ensure all dispatch documentation follows CAA and DFT regulations. Ensure the correct vehicles are allocated for the correct requirement. Print tickets when out of hours aircraft or flight changes happen. Liaise with all departments in the event of aircraft or flight changes. Full and clear operational logs to be maintained and completed. Ensuring COSHH and HACCP, are always adhered to. Conduct primary security checks of the airline equipment in accordance with both CAA and DfT regulations. Conduct vehicle security searches in accordance with both CAA and DfT regulations. Always interact with colleagues and clients on site in a professional manner. Comply with all unit Corporate, Social, Responsibility initiatives. Ensure you are aware and comply with QHSE policies & procedures
